## Authentication

Plugins that read from the Orchella product catalog must authenticate before subscribing to cache-invalidation events. Each invalidation message is signed, and stale entries are purged within five seconds of a catalog write. Requests without valid credentials receive only the public snapshot. For local testing against the sandbox tier, use the key below.

service key, yadug-bajog: zpat3_pou

## Runbook: SDK Parity Checks (Lanternkit)

This fragment covers verifying feature parity between the Lanternkit Swift and Kotlin SDKs before each release. As a contractor, run the parity harness against both builds; it diffs the exposed feature matrix and flags any method missing from either side. Known intentional gaps are listed in the exclusions file — do not "fix" those. The harness reads the service configuration values below.

service settings:
PRAIX_LOG_LEVEL=error
PRAIX_METRICS_HOST=metrics.praix.qorvelcorp.corp
PRAIX_POOL_SIZE=16

### Partitioning

Quillmark partitions `event_log` by calendar month. New partitions are created two months ahead by the scheduler; old ones detach after the retention horizon and drop a week later. Do not change the partition key without rebuilding indexes. Backfills must target the correct partition directly or the planner degrades badly. Constants governing this are:

limits module of yadug-tawip:
QUOTAS = {
    "julael": 705,
    "kasael": 903,
    "druwyn": 489,
}